Two of the most popular robot vacuums of 2026 are the Roborock Qrevo S5V and the Dreame X40 Ultra. Both are excellent — but they’re aimed at different buyers. Here’s how they compare and which one you should pick.
| Feature | Roborock Qrevo S5V | Dreame X40 Ultra |
|---|---|---|
| Suction | 12,000 Pa | 12,000 Pa |
| Edge mopping | FlexiArm extendable | Extendable + liftable pads |
| Brush tangle control | Dual zero-tangle | Anti-tangle + liftable side brush |
| Dock | Self-empty, mop wash & dry | Auto-empty, auto-refill, 158°F wash |
| Price | ~$499.98 | ~$599.99 |
You want Roborock’s dependable navigation and the lowest long-term price. The dual zero-tangle system is excellent for pet hair, and the 10 mm mop lift keeps carpets dry during mixed-floor cleans. It’s the better value pick for most homes.
